What Is a Carrier Contract?

A carrier contract is an agreement between a mobile device user and a wireless service provider. It typically includes a commitment to use the carrier’s network for a specified period, often 24 or 36 months, in exchange for subsidized device prices or installment plans.

How Carrier Contracts Affect Trade-In Prices

Carrier contracts can impact the trade-in value of your Pixel 8 256GB Mint in several ways:

  • Eligibility for Trade-In: Some carriers require devices to be fully paid off before accepting trade-ins, which can delay or reduce the trade-in value.
  • Device Condition: Contract obligations may restrict the ability to trade in damaged or heavily used devices without penalties.
  • Trade-In Promotions: Carriers often offer special trade-in deals or bonuses for customers committed to their network, increasing the trade-in value.
  • Carrier Restrictions: Certain carriers may have exclusive agreements that limit trade-in options or affect the resale value of the device.

Trade-In Strategies for Pixel 8 256GB Mint

To maximize your trade-in value, consider the following strategies:

  • Pay Off Your Contract: Ensure your device is fully paid off before trading in to avoid restrictions.
  • Check Carrier Policies: Review your carrier’s trade-in terms and conditions for device eligibility.
  • Compare Offers: Look at trade-in deals from multiple carriers and third-party vendors to find the best value.
  • Maintain Device Condition: Keep your Pixel 8 in good condition to fetch higher trade-in prices.
